Under its firm commitment to supporting local youth talent and capabilities, Orange Jordan sponsored the closing ceremony of the student competition titled "Robots Line Follower”, organized by the Robotics and Automation Society (RAS), a sub-branch of the IEEE Student Club at Princess Sumaya University for Technology (PSUT), in which students competed to design and build fully autonomous robots entirely from scratch.The competition stood out for its criteria, which aimed to stimulate creative thinking and encourage the development of technological solutions that go beyond conventional boundaries. These included complete autonomy in designing and programming each robot from scratch, while ensuring the uniqueness of every solution and prohibiting the use of pre-built robots or pre-assembled configurations.In addition, the challenge focused on enhancing flexibility and adaptability by exposing participants to real-world challenges under pressure, requiring them to readjust and calibrate their robots’ algorithms to adapt to sudden, previously unannounced tracks during the elimination rounds.Orange Jordan affirmed that this sponsorship aligns with its vision to foster a culture of digital innovation and strengthen the capabilities of the next generation of programmers and innovators, empowering them to transform their ambitious ideas into tangible projects and competitive technological solutions.Furthermore, this challenge reflects the long-standing strategic partnership between the company and leading academic institutions to accelerate technological advancements in the Kingdom, while encouraging youth potential and their role in creating a positive, sustainable impact on society through their solutions.It’s worth mentioning that the collaborative journey between Orange Jordan and PSUT extends far beyond supporting events and competitions. Both parties actively contribute to shaping the future of the digital economy and empowering Jordanian entrepreneurs. In this context, this strategic partnership contributed to the graduation of 14 startups from the second and third cohorts of the AI Incubator of the Orange Digital Center in 2025.To learn more, please visit our website: www.orange.jo
